Challenges and Best Practices in Tracking Results

Overcoming Common Challenges in Data Analysis for Wellness Programs

Navigating the complexities of data analysis for wellness programs can be daunting. In this section, we discuss common challenges such as data silos, incomplete datasets, and data interpretation biases. By addressing these obstacles head-on and implementing robust data collection processes, companies can unlock the full potential of data analytics to track the effectiveness of their B2B Massage programs.

Best Practices for Ensuring Data Accuracy and Interpretation

To extract meaningful insights from data analytics, it is crucial to prioritize data accuracy and interpretation. By adhering to best practices such as data validation, regular data cleansing, and training employees on data literacy, organizations can trust the integrity of their data analytics results. Ensuring data accuracy lays a strong foundation for informed decision-making and impactful wellness program outcomes.

FAQ

1. Why is data analytics important for tracking the results of corporate B2B Massage programs?

Data analytics provides valuable insights into the effectiveness of B2B Massage programs by measuring key metrics such as employee engagement, participation rates, and overall impact on well-being. This data enables organizations to make data-driven decisions and optimize their wellness initiatives for maximum ROI.

2. What are some common challenges in utilizing data analytics for corporate wellness programs?

Common challenges include data accuracy and integrity, limited resources for data analysis, and ensuring privacy and security of employee information. Overcoming these challenges requires implementing robust data management systems, investing in training for staff, and adhering to strict data protection protocols.

3. How can organizations maximize the impact of their corporate B2B Massage programs through data analytics?

Organizations can maximize impact by identifying and tracking relevant metrics, leveraging data insights to tailor programs to employee needs, and continuously monitoring and adjusting strategies based on data outcomes. By utilizing data analytics strategically, companies can enhance employee engagement, improve well-being outcomes, and drive overall program success.
